Output 2dfd3e446d39d0cd84adfb7323b71f71a53f808696d304580e14d429d7a641d2: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021ae059af27429c716a4dda2af98c47423c4e45 OP_EQUAL
address
31t9UL7AFKZkeXn2ctAbYCMq6mvo83vy5o
transaction
2dfd3e446d39d0cd84adfb7323b71f71a53f808696d304580e14d429d7a641d2
confirmations
306156
spent
true